Ferry times from Provincetown to Boston

Provincetown Boston ferry sailings typycally depart from Provincetown at around 11:30. The last ferry leaves at 21:00.

How long is the ferry from Provincetown to Boston?

The Provincetown Boston ferry trip can take around 1 hour 35 minutes. Crossing times can vary between ferry operator and seasons.

How far is it from Provincetown to Boston?

The distance between Provincetown to Boston is approximately 60 miles (97km) or 52 nautical miles.

Can I travel by car on the Provincetown Boston ferry?

Ferry Operators servcing ferries from Provincetown to Boston currently do not allow cars to travel onboard.

Can I travel as a foot passenger from Provincetown to Boston?

Foot passengers can travel on the Provincetown to Boston ferry with Boston Harbor City Cruises.

Can I take my pet on the ferry from Provincetown to Boston?

Pets currently are not allowed on ferries from Provincetown to Boston.

Widely known as ‘Beantown’ after its proficiency in Baked Beans production, Boston is famed for the superb educational premises located in the city, including two of America’s most prestigious universities – M.I.T and Harvard. The large student population gives the town somewhat of an edgy, energetic vibe, and also contributes to the relatively diverse population. For those that have an active interest in history, there are also numerous museums around the city. Away from history and education, sports is a huge part of the city’s culture, with the Boston Red Sox being one of the most famous baseball teams in the world. Several films have also been set in the city, including The Departed, The Social Network and Good Will Hunting, providing a fascinating tour for movie buffs. After watching a baseball game or witnessing the film settings, Boston has an array of excellent restaurants perfect for enjoying an evening meal. Some restaurants employ deliberately surly waitresses, living up to the city’s sometimes grouchy reputation. How to get around Boston One of the most favourable aspects of Boston is the ease in which tourists can get around. It is very possible to get around the city by foot, with the major attractions located in the city centre and in relatively close proximity. For access to the port, there are several road links, as well as a train running directly to the port.
